2009 Splendid Artist Lachlan Tetlow-Stuart has been commissioned to present A Someone Else’s Problem Field as part of Next Wave Time Lapse at Federation Square, Melbourne. Next Wave Time Lapse is a year-long program of new screen-based work by young and emerging artists presented every Thursday night (5:30 – 6:30pm) on Federation Square’s Big Screen.
A Someone Else’s Problem Field is a site-specific work that employs Augmented Reality. Appearing at first to be a simple live-feed from Federation Square to the Big Screen, audiences will be disturbed and delighted as subtle interventions slowly become apparent, and distinctions between reality and fiction become blurred.
Lachlan’s work will be viewable on Thursday 3 December, Thursday 10 December, Friday 18 December, Thursday 24 December and Thursday 31 December 2009, 5:30 – 6:30pm.
